Features
A lightweight power wheelchair is an ideal mobility option for those with a limited physical strength. These chairs offer a range of features that improve the user's quality of life and enable them to navigate different environments without difficulty. They can be easily moved to different locations, since they fold down to a compact size. This feature allows the product to be easily put in a trunk of a vehicle or on public transport without an additional vehicle.
In addition to the folding feature electric wheelchairs that are lightweight come with a smaller frame that is more mobile than traditional wheelchairs. They can be pushed through narrow doors and spaces, like hallways on cruise ships. They are a great choice for people who require a light and portable chair to run errands, visit friends, or travel across the globe.
A lightweight power wheelchair can reach speeds of up to 8mph when going uphill and 5mph on flat surfaces. They can also traverse different types of terrain, such as gravel, grass, and paved sidewalks. These mobility solutions come in a variety of colors and sizes so you can pick one that matches your personal style.
Some power wheelchairs also have special features that improve the comfort and efficiency of the user. Certain power wheelchairs feature the option of a free-wheel that allows the wheelchair to be manually moved. This is an important security feature, since it could keep the chair from rolling away if the battery goes out. Some chairs also come with elevating mechanisms that raise the seat to a level that makes it easier for the user to reach day-to-day objects or to meet at eye level with others when talking.

Weight
Weight is a very important aspect to take into consideration when buying an electric wheelchair, particularly when you intend to use it often outside of your home. To ensure optimal performance and safety, the total weight of the chair should be kept as low as is possible. This will also reduce the stress on the motor and battery.
The best portable power wheelchairs fold down and move easily. They usually come with brushless motors without gears that enhance battery life and boost speed. They also have a special suspension technology and stability to ensure the chair remains in balance.
Depending on the model, some chairs can move at speeds of up to 3 or 4 mph, which is comparable to the speed most people walk. This enables people to move faster and make it easier to access shelves and other objects in their homes. The chairs can be used on public transport to allow them to get to and from their work without the need of a car.
These chairs are also easy to transport and can be easily tucked away in a trunk of any car or truck. These chairs are airline friendly, and can be taken on domestic and international flights. Some models are equipped with flame proof and spill proof batteries that are TSA approved.
Many people use their portable power wheelchairs to shop or visit friends and family members, as well as for other activities. In reality, this kind of chair can improve an individual's quality of life by allowing them to take part in activities that they might otherwise be unable to participate in.
Battery life
The battery life is a crucial aspect to take into consideration when selecting an electric folding wheelchair. You need to ensure that you can use the chair as long as you want, without having to worry about running out of battery power. On the manufacturer's site, you can find out more about the battery and how much range you can expect following a full charge.
If you're looking for a light alternative, consider models that feature a lithium battery. They are smaller than traditional batteries and have a longer time. However, it's important to understand that even lithium batteries will eventually wear out due to regular usage. Don't drain your batteries to the point of no return and use good charging techniques to extend their lifespan.
Another crucial aspect to think about when looking for an electric wheelchair is its maneuverability. You'll need to move comfortably and easily in your new chair visiting friends or doing errands. Look for specifics like the turning radius of your new chair to ensure it can be easily and quickly adjusted when required.
